After 28 years of service, Paksitan Air Force formally retired A-5C Fantans on 18th March. A-5 was a Chinese made visual day attack aircraft capable of carrying short range heat guided missiles, free fall bombs and rockets. A-5 was a modified version of F-6 (Mig-19) with a nose cone and an attack computer.
PAF had 55 of these types distributed in two squadrons (No.16 and No.26) based at Peshawar AFB which are now getting equipped with state of the art JF-17s.
